Japan Tetrahydrofurfuryl Methacrylate (THFMA) Market Size Analysis: Addressable Demand and Growth Potential

The Japan Tetrahydrofurfuryl Methacrylate (THFMA) market is positioned at a strategic intersection of specialty chemicals and high-performance polymers. As a niche monomer with unique properties, THFMA is increasingly adopted across various industrial applications, notably in coatings, adhesives, and advanced composites. This section delineates the market size, growth potential, and segmentation logic, providing a comprehensive TAM, SAM, and SOM analysis.

  • Total Addressable Market (TAM): – Estimated at approximately USD 150 million globally by 2028, with Japan accounting for roughly 25-30% due to its advanced chemical industry and innovation-driven manufacturing sector. – The TAM encompasses all potential applications of THFMA across coatings, adhesives, sealants, and specialty polymers worldwide.
  • Serviceable Available Market (SAM): – Focused on the Asia-Pacific region, with Japan representing a significant share owing to high R&D activity and stringent quality standards. – Estimated at USD 45-50 million, considering the current adoption rates and regional demand for high-performance materials.
  • Serviceable Obtainable Market (SOM): – Realistically, within the next 3-5 years, Japanese manufacturers and specialty chemical companies could capture USD 15-20 million of the market, driven by strategic partnerships, product innovation, and regulatory compliance.

The segmentation logic is based on:

  • Application Segments: Coatings & paints (40%), adhesives & sealants (30%), specialty polymers (20%), others (10%).
  • End-User Industries: Automotive, electronics, construction, packaging, and healthcare sectors.
  • Geographic Boundaries: Japan as the primary market, with secondary focus on neighboring regions for export and collaboration opportunities.

Adoption rates are projected to grow at a CAGR of approximately 8-10% over the next five years, driven by increasing demand for durable, eco-friendly, and high-performance materials. Penetration scenarios suggest that early adopters in high-end coatings and specialty adhesives will lead growth, with broader industry adoption following as manufacturing standards evolve.

Japan Tetrahydrofurfuryl Methacrylate (THFMA) Market Commercialization Outlook & Revenue Opportunities

The commercialization landscape for THFMA in Japan presents compelling revenue opportunities, supported by evolving industry needs and technological advancements. This section explores business models, growth drivers, segment-specific opportunities, operational challenges, and regulatory considerations.

  • Business Model Attractiveness & Revenue Streams: – Primarily driven by specialty chemical manufacturing, licensing, and custom synthesis services. – Revenue streams include direct sales to OEMs, formulation partnerships, and co-development agreements. – Potential for high-margin niche products tailored for specific applications such as UV-curable coatings or bio-based adhesives.
  • Growth Drivers & Demand Acceleration Factors: – Increasing regulatory pressure for environmentally friendly and sustainable materials. – Rising demand for high-performance, durable coatings in automotive and electronics sectors. – Technological innovations enabling lower-cost synthesis and improved product performance. – Strategic initiatives by Japanese chemical giants to diversify product portfolios with specialty monomers.
  • Segment-wise Opportunities:Region: Focus on industrial hubs such as Tokyo, Osaka, and Nagoya for early adoption. – Application: Coatings & paints (highest growth potential), adhesives, and specialty polymers. – Customer Type: Large OEMs, R&D institutions, and niche formulators seeking high-value additives.
  • Scalability Challenges & Operational Bottlenecks: – Limited manufacturing capacity for high-purity THFMA. – Supply chain complexities for raw materials and intermediates. – Need for advanced process control to ensure consistent quality.
  • Regulatory Landscape, Certifications & Compliance: – Compliance with Japan’s Chemical Substances Control Law (CSCL) and REACH-like regulations. – Certification requirements for industrial use, including safety data sheets (SDS) and eco-labeling. – Timeline for regulatory approvals typically spans 12-24 months, emphasizing early engagement with authorities.
